Definitions:

Hallucinations

Perceptions or sensations experienced without the presence of external stimuli, often auditory or visual in nature.

Compulsions

Are repetitive behaviors or mental acts that a person feels the need to perform in response to an obsession or according to rigidly applied rules.

Dissociative Fugue

A rare psychological state in which a person temporarily loses their sense of personal identity and may impulsively travel or wander away from their usual surroundings.

Panic Disorder

A psychiatric disorder characterized by sudden episodes of intense fear or anxiety and physical symptoms, such as heart palpitations and dizziness.
